| 1 | AN ACT concerning State government. | ||||||
| 2 | Be it enacted by the People of the State of Illinois, | ||||||
| 3 | represented in the General Assembly: | ||||||
| 4 | Section 5. The Department of Transportation Law of the | ||||||
| 5 | Civil Administrative Code of Illinois is amended by changing | ||||||
| 6 | Section 2705-210 as follows: | ||||||
| 7 | (20 ILCS 2705/2705-210) (was 20 ILCS 2705/49.15) | ||||||
| 8 | Sec. 2705-210. Traffic control and prevention of crashes. | ||||||
| 9 | (a) The Department has the power to develop, consolidate, | ||||||
| 10 | and coordinate effective programs and activities for the | ||||||
| 11 | advancement of driver education, for the facilitation of the | ||||||
| 12 | movement of motor vehicle traffic, and for the protection and | ||||||
| 13 | conservation of life and property on the streets and highways | ||||||
| 14 | of this State and to advise, recommend, and consult with the | ||||||
| 15 | several departments, divisions, boards, commissions, and other | ||||||
| 16 | agencies of this State in regard to those programs and | ||||||
| 17 | activities. The Department has the power to aid and assist the | ||||||
| 18 | counties, cities, towns, and other political subdivisions of | ||||||
| 19 | this State in the control of traffic and the prevention of | ||||||
| 20 | traffic crashes. That aid and assistance to counties, cities, | ||||||
| 21 | towns, and other political subdivisions of this State shall | ||||||
| 22 | include assistance with regard to planning, traffic flow, | ||||||
| 23 | light synchronizing, preferential lanes for carpools, and | ||||||

| 1 | carpool parking allocations. | ||||||
| 2 | (b) To further the prevention of crashes, the Department | ||||||
| 3 | shall conduct a traffic study following the occurrence of any | ||||||
| 4 | crash involving a pedestrian fatality that occurs at an | ||||||
| 5 | intersection of a State highway. The study shall include, but | ||||||
| 6 | not be limited to, consideration of alternative geometric | ||||||
| 7 | design improvements, traffic control devices, and any other | ||||||
| 8 | improvements that the Department deems necessary to reduce | ||||||
| 9 | traffic crashes and fatalities at the location. The Department | ||||||
| 10 | shall make the results of the study available to the public on | ||||||
| 11 | its website. | ||||||
| 12 | (1) As part of the study, the Department shall | ||||||
| 13 | identify trends, patterns, and correlations including, but | ||||||
| 14 | not limited to, trends, patterns, and correlations | ||||||
| 15 | associated with the occurrence of fatal or serious injury | ||||||
| 16 | traffic crash outcomes in pedestrians and bicyclists | ||||||
| 17 | population groups. | ||||||
| 18 | (2) If appropriate, the Department shall conduct | ||||||
| 19 | analyses and identify potential actions to increase | ||||||
| 20 | traffic safety, which may include, but are not limited to, | ||||||
| 21 | modifications to street design and infrastructure. | ||||||
| 22 | (3) In conducting analyses and in identifying | ||||||
| 23 | potential actions, the Department shall coordinate with | ||||||
| 24 | any other department, agency, or organization deemed | ||||||
| 25 | relevant by the Department. | ||||||
| 26 | (4) The Department shall make the reports of the | ||||||
| |||||||
| |||||||
| 1 | analyses and results of the study available to the public | ||||||
| 2 | upon request. | ||||||
| 3 | (Source: P.A. 102-333, eff. 1-1-22; 102-982, eff. 7-1-23.) | ||||||
